*Software Engineer-QA* Mobile : +94 (0) 775246619 <+94+(0)+775246619> *nay...@wso2.com <nay...@wso2.com>* On Wed, Oct 14, 2015 at 12:37 PM, Inosh Goonewardena <in...@wso2.com> wrote: > Hi Nayomi, > > > On Wed, Oct 14, 2015 at 11:07 AM, Nayomi Dayarathne <nay...@wso2.com> > wrote: > >> Hi DAS team, >> >> I need below clarifications regarding the command that we used to >> migrate data from BAM to DAS using analytic migration tool. >> >> I used below command to migrate data from a table in BAM to DAS >> >> ./analytics-migrate.sh -serverUrl <DAS_SERVER_URL> -cassandra_Url >> <CASSANDRA_URL> -serverPort <DAS_PORT> -columnFamily >> <COLUMN_FAMILY-NAME> -analyticTable <ANALYTICS_TABLE_NAME> -batchSize >> 1000 -tenantId -1234 -username <CASSANDRA_SERVER_USERNAME> >> -password <CASSANDRA_SERVER_PASSWORD> -cassandraPort <CASSANDRA_PORT> >> -clusterName <CLUSTER_NAME> >> >> 1. Are there any optional and mandatory parameters in the command ? >> >> Because when we remove <DAS_SERVER_URL> and <DAS_PORT> parameters and >> run the command, it still migrate data from BAM to DAS. >> > > Server URL and server port(CQL port) are no longer needed for migration. > So we can actually remove those properties completely from the command. > > >> >> 2. If we are migrating data from multiple tables from BAM to DAS, how >> do we define it in the command ? >> > > Migrating data from multiple tables is not supported at the moment. > >> >> >> Regards, >> >> Nayomi Dayarathne >> Software Engineer-QA >> Mobile : +94 (0) 775246619 >> nay...@wso2.com >> _______________________________________________ >> Dev mailing list >> Dev@wso2.org >> http://wso2.org/cgi-bin/mailman/listinfo/dev >> > > > > -- > Thanks & Regards, > > Inosh Goonewardena > Associate Technical Lead- WSO2 Inc. > Mobile: +94779966317 >
